Natural stone sealing services involve applying a protective coating to surfaces made of natural stone, such as granite, marble, limestone, or slate. This process helps create a barrier that prevents liquids, oils, and stains from penetrating the stone’s surface. Proper sealing enhances the durability of the stone, making it more resistant to everyday wear and tear. Service providers typically assess the specific type of stone and recommend the appropriate sealant to ensure optimal protection, helping homeowners maintain the appearance and integrity of their natural stone features over time.

Sealing services are especially valuable in addressing common problems like staining, etching, and surface deterioration. Without proper protection, natural stone surfaces are vulnerable to spills from food, beverages, or cleaning products, which can cause permanent discoloration or damage. Additionally, porous stones are more prone to absorbing moisture, leading to potential cracking or mold growth. Professional sealing helps mitigate these issues by reducing porosity and creating a surface that is easier to clean and maintain, thus extending the lifespan of the stone features.

Many types of properties benefit from natural stone sealing services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and outdoor spaces. Homeowners often seek sealing for kitchen countertops, bathroom vanities, fireplace surrounds, and patio paving. Commercial property owners may have stone flooring, lobby features, or outdoor walkways that require protection against heavy foot traffic and weather exposure. Outdoor spaces like patios, walkways, and pool surrounds are particularly susceptible to staining and weather-related damage, making sealing an important step in preserving their appearance and functionality.

What is the purpose of sealing natural stone surfaces? Sealing helps protect natural stone surfaces from stains, moisture, and damage, maintaining their appearance and durability over time.

How often should natural stone be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the type of stone and usage, but generally, it is recommended to reseal every 1 to 3 years to ensure ongoing protection.

What types of natural stone surfaces can be sealed? Natural stone sealing services typically cover surfaces such as granite, marble, limestone, travertine, and slate used in flooring, countertops, and outdoor patios.
